#798b74 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#798b74 is composed of 47.5% red, 54.5%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 107 degrees, a saturation of 9% and a lightness of 50%. #798b74 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ffe8 with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#798b74

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b09 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#798b74

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f817e is the less saturated color, while #3cf708 is the most saturated one.
